What Is Reflexed?

Reflexed is a specialized Health & Fitness utility that enables patients and physiotherapists to measure and track body range of motion (ROM) using photo-based goniometry. Released in February 2025, it positions itself as a precise, data-driven tool for rehabilitation and fitness assessment. Its primary differentiator is the ability to calculate precise angles from photos, providing instant feedback and longitudinal tracking in a simplified mobile interface.

The rivals identified

The Nemesis

  1. -

    Full-suite HEP vs. Niche Utility: Medbridge provides comprehensive video-guided exercise programs and adherence tracking, whereas Reflexed focuses exclusively on the specific measurement of range-of-motion (ROM) via photos.

  2. -

    B2B2C Distribution Model: Medbridge is typically prescribed by a clinician through a corporate subscription, while Reflexed positions itself as a standalone tool for both patients and independent practitioners.

What are the next best moves?

high

Implement a 'Clinical Export' feature (PDF/CSV)

The target audience includes physiotherapists who need to document ROM for professional assessments; currently, the app only tracks within the UI.

high

Launch a review acquisition campaign

The app currently has 0 ratings and 0 reviews, which is a significant barrier to trust for a clinical/health tool.

medium

Develop a 'Patient-Provider' link or messaging loop

The Nemesis (Medbridge GO) includes integrated messaging, a feature Reflexed currently lacks according to competitor analysis.

Feature Gaps vs Competitors

  • Video-guided exercise programs (available in Medbridge GO)
  • Integrated patient-therapist messaging (available in Medbridge GO)
  • Adherence tracking (available in Medbridge GO)

Key Takeaways

Reflexed is a high-utility niche tool that successfully digitizes a manual clinical process (goniometry), but it currently lacks the ecosystem stickiness of its primary rival, Medbridge GO. To succeed, the PM must move beyond a standalone utility by adding clinical export capabilities and addressing the total lack of social proof.
